Key Points:

  • NVIDIA's RTX PRO 6000 Blackwell graphics card has seen a significant price increase, now officially listed at $13,250, over 60% higher than its initial launch price of around $8,000.
  • The steep price hike is primarily attributed to memory shortages, as the card features a record 96 GB of GDDR7 VRAM, which is currently in limited supply.
  • The NVIDIA RTX 5090 graphics card has also experienced price increases, now retailing above $4,000, more than double its original MSRP of $1,999.
  • Despite these substantial price rises, strong demand from the AI sector continues to drive sales, as these GPUs offer unmatched performance and VRAM capacity.
  • The market for NVIDIA’s top-tier graphics cards remains tight, with prices showing little sign of decreasing, challenging both professionals and enthusiasts.
